The more security in protecting yourselves from unwanted pilfering, the 
better.  Bolt it /strap it/ glue it down if you have to, even so, the place 
does not need to look like Fort Knox to be thief unfriendly.   Cameras are 
also a good deterrent.
I must admit that with all the concern about individuals getting into your 
machines and causing damage, the waters have been muddied, there is far 
more to worry about with theft and vandalism.
There are ways of tagging even relatively small items that set off alarms 
as you leave a premises.  Smaller scale of the average shop tagging system. 
 This would act as a detterent to those opportunists who would walk off 
with headphones, mouses, PC's keyboards etc.
It costs about ?0.03 (3p) per tag.  The detector equipment (loop) for 
entrance points cost about ?1000 - 3000 per door.
